Services at assisted living facilities are available to those who cannot continue staying in their own homes due to safety concerns, but who don’t require the advanced level of care that hospitals and nursing homes provide. Staff members at assisted living communities usually help seniors with meal preparation, personal care, light housekeeping and other daily tasks. Assisted living costs average $4,750 per month in Sterling Heights, which is around 10% higher than the median rate of $4,300 across the United States.
